Today's enhancement to Headline Animator, the FeedBurner service engaged in a renovation comparable to the Dan Ryan expressway reconstruction project (minus the many reflector barrels), is all about expanding the reach of your content and making things look how you want them to look.
Place Your Content in More Places, Easily
It has been suggested by considerably more than seven of you that we should offer new capabilities to help grow your audience, and that's exactly what we're committed to doing with Headline Animator. It now features step-by-step instructions for placing your content on your MySpace page, a TypePad, Blogger or WordPress.com blog, a bunch of email programs, and "Other," a category we reserve for those interesting places whose names aren't reflected in the drop-down menu.

Word Wrap
Not everyone appreciates the sangfroid of a compact headline (note this post). For you and us, caution may be thrown to the wind by applying word wrap to individual post headlines. Word wrap is turned off by default so as not to potentially overwrite any background text, but since you know your Headline Animator better than anyone you may activate it by clicking a simple checkbox if the spirit (or more likely, the linebreak) moves you.
